+<p>
+Settings overrides are a way for extensions to override selected Chrome settings
+and user interface properties.
+</p>
+
+<p>
+An extension can override the following properties:
+</p>
+
+<p>
+<b>Bookmarks User Interface:</b>
+<ul>
+ <li>
+ Bookmark button: the "star" button that appears on the right side of the
+ omnibox. Extensions may remove this button using the settings overrides, and
+ optionally replace it with a browser action or page action.
+ </li>
+
+ <li>
+ Bookmark shortcut: the shortcut key that is used to bookmark a page (Ctrl-D
+ on Windows). Extensions may remove this shortcut via the settings overrides,
+ and optionally bind their own command to it using the <code>commands</code>
+ section of the manifest.
+ </li>
+</ul>
+</p>
+
+<p class="note">
+<b>Note:</b> Settings overrides are only enabled in the Chrome Dev release, and
+Chrome must be started with the <code>--enable-override-bookmarks-ui=1</code>
+command line flag to enable bookmarks user interface overrides.</p>
+
+<h2 id="manifest">Manifest</h2>
+
+<p>
+Register settings overrides in the
+<a href="manifest.html">extension manifest</a> like this:
+</p>
+
+<pre>{
+ "name": "My extension",
+ ...
+
+<b> "chrome_settings_overrides" : {
+ "bookmarks_ui": {
+ "remove_button": "true",
+ "remove_bookmark_shortcut": "true"
+ }
+ }</b>,
+ ...
+}</pre>
